Should You Replace Your Furnace and Air Conditioner at the Same Time?

HVAC technician kneeling beside an open gas furnace during a furnace and air conditioner replacement in a Kitchener-Waterloo basement

If both units are aging, replacing your furnace and air conditioner at the same time often makes sense, especially when the crew already has the system opened up. But it is not automatic. The right call depends on the age of each unit, the state of the shared coil, and what your budget can carry this year.

Here is the idea the whole decision turns on. Your furnace and central AC are not two separate appliances that happen to share a basement. They are one air-moving system with two heat sources. They share a blower, an indoor coil, the ductwork, and a refrigerant line. That shared plumbing is why “replace both” is even a question worth asking.

So the real fork is simple: do both now, or stage them one at a time. A new furnace installation and a central ac installation both cost real money, and this guide walks through when each approach wins and when it does not.

The Quick Answer: Should You Replace the Furnace and AC Together?

Replace the furnace and AC together when both are old enough that one is likely to fail soon after the other, or when the coil has to come out regardless. Stage them when one unit is clearly newer and running well.

Lean toward replacing both together when:

  • Both units are 12 or more years old.
  • The indoor coil has to come out for the job anyway.
  • You want a true matched pair that hits its rated efficiency.

Lean toward replacing just one when:

  • The other unit is clearly newer with years of service left.
  • Your budget only stretches to one this season.

Your Furnace and AC Are One System, Not Two

Picture what actually sits in your basement. A gas furnace stands indoors. An AC condenser sits outside. Between them, mounted on top of the furnace, is an indoor evaporator coil. The furnace’s blower is the fan that pushes cooled air through your ducts in summer and heated air in winter. One coil cabinet, one blower, one set of ducts, one refrigerant line-set tying the outdoor unit to the indoor coil. That is the shared hardware that makes “should I do both” a real question and not a marketing upsell.

The Shared Coil and Blower Are What Earn the Rating

The efficiency number on an air conditioner is a team score, not a solo score. Natural Resources Canada is direct about it: the indoor and outdoor components are meant to operate together, and the rated efficiency comes from tests of those components working as one combination. The outdoor condenser earns the rating with the specific indoor coil and the blower that moves air across it. Change one part of that trio and the tested combination no longer exists. So when you read a high SEER2 figure on a new condenser, understand what it assumes: a matching coil and a blower that can actually move the air the rating was measured with.

Why a New AC on an Old Coil Falls Short

Here is the catch that costs people money. When a central AC is replaced, the existing indoor coil should be replaced with one matched to the new outdoor unit, or the new unit will not deliver its rated efficiency. Bolt a high-efficiency condenser onto a worn coil and an old single-speed blower, and you paid for a number you will never see on your hydro bill. The condenser can only perform as well as the weakest part it is tied to. This single fact is the strongest reason the two halves so often move together: the moment you touch the AC, the coil is already on the table.

When Replacing Both Together Is the Smart Move

Two HVAC technicians installing a new outdoor air conditioner condenser beside a suburban Kitchener-Waterloo home in summer

Doing both at once is not a blanket rule. It is a set of specific situations where combining the work saves you money, saves you a second disruption, or protects the performance you are paying for. Here are the ones that come up most in Kitchener-Waterloo homes.

Both Units Are Near the End of Their Life

Furnaces tend to outlive AC units by a few years, so when one gives up the other is often close behind. There is no fixed expiry date stamped on either machine. In our experience across the region, a well-kept furnace tends to run about 15 to 20 years and a central AC about 12 to 15, which means the two often reach the end of the road within a few seasons of each other. If your AC dies at 14 years and the furnace is 17, replacing the survivor within a couple of years is likely anyway. Doing both now avoids paying twice to open, drain, and re-commission the same cabinet. For the full picture on how long a central AC lasts and what shortens it, the lifespan detail is worth a read on its own.

You Are Already Opening Up the Coil Cabinet

A new furnace usually means a new coil cabinet, and a new AC means a new matched coil. Either way, the expensive access work is the same work. Once the coil is being touched, the math for “do both” shifts hard, because the labour you would pay for twice happens once.

Two separate points sit behind this, and they should not be blurred together. The first is the efficiency point above: a new condenser on an old coil generally will not deliver its rated efficiency. The second is a practical one from our own installs. In our experience, a mismatched coil can also affect your manufacturer warranty, since equipment makers assume the coil and condenser are the matched pair they certified. We flag both because they push the same direction: if the coil is coming out, matching the whole system is usually the cleaner call.

Why One Visit Usually Costs Less Than Two

Combining the work saves money because so much of an HVAC job is setup, not parts. One crew mobilizes once. One refrigerant evacuation and recharge. One coil-cabinet teardown. One commissioning and airflow balance at the end. Split the project into two visits and you duplicate most of that overhead. The equipment costs what it costs either way, but the labour and access are where doing it together tends to come out ahead. Matching the Refrigerant Platform

New central air conditioners are moving to lower-emission refrigerants such as R-454B and R-32, while R-410A stays available to service the system you already own. You cannot mix refrigerants across a coil and a condenser, so a matched replacement keeps both halves on the same platform from day one. If you replace only the outdoor unit and leave an older indoor coil, you can end up managing a platform mismatch later. The exact changeover dates come from federal regulation and from each manufacturer, so we confirm what applies to your specific install when we quote it.

When Replacing Just One Makes Sense

Doing both is not always right, and we will tell you when it is not. Staging the work is a legitimate decision path, not a consolation prize. Here are the two situations where replacing a single unit is the smarter move.

If One Unit Still Has Years Left

If your furnace or your AC is clearly newer and running well, there is little sense in tearing out a healthy machine just to match its partner. A five-year-old furnace paired with a dead AC does not need replacing to keep the system honest. What you do watch in that case is compatibility: whether the surviving coil still matches the new outdoor unit, and whether the refrigerant platforms line up. Get those two answers before you commit, and a single replacement can be the right, cheaper call.

If Your Budget Only Stretches to One Right Now

Sometimes the honest answer is to fix the failure in front of you now and plan the second half for later. That is fine, as long as you stage it well. The trap is paying twice to open the same cabinet, so we plan the first visit with the second one in mind: matched components where it counts, and a clear note on what the follow-up job needs. Then, when the second unit is ready, you can weigh a full matched replacement against another partial one and choose with the real numbers in front of you rather than under the pressure of a mid-summer breakdown.

Efficiency: What AFUE and SEER2 Mean for a Matched Pair

If you replace both, this is where the payoff shows up on your bills. There are two ratings at work, one for each heat source, but they run through the same shared blower and ducts. Getting them right together is what a matched pair buys you.

What AFUE Tells You About the Furnace

AFUE measures how much of the fuel your furnace burns actually becomes heat over a full season. New gas furnaces sold in Canada must meet a 95% AFUE minimum, so a modern replacement is high-efficiency by design. That is worth knowing before you shop: the floor is already high. What SEER2 Tells You About the AC

SEER2 is the current efficiency scale for central air conditioners, and it is a matched-system rating, which ties straight back to the point about the coil and blower. Every new central AC sold in Canada has to meet a minimum efficiency standard, and today’s units are rated on the SEER2 scale. The higher the number, the less electricity the unit draws to move the same heat out of your home. Sizing the Pair Correctly

Replacing both at once is the moment to size the system correctly, not just swap like-for-like. Capacity should be chosen to just meet your home’s calculated design cooling load. Oversizing backfires: an AC that is too big runs in short cycles that cool the air fast but never run long enough to pull humidity out, so the house feels clammy even while the thermostat reads fine. Rule-of-thumb sizing off the old unit’s tonnage is exactly what a proper load calculation replaces. When both halves are new, a right-sized, matched pair is the version that actually delivers comfort and the efficiency you paid for.

Rebates and Your Real Options in Ontario

Modern outdoor heat pump unit installed beside a suburban Ontario home

Let us be straight about the money, because there is a common myth here. Many homeowners assume a big government rebate is waiting for a furnace and AC replacement. In Ontario in 2026, that is not how the programs work. The former Enbridge Home Efficiency Rebate Plus is closed to new applicants. The current program is Home Renovation Savings, delivered through Save on Energy, and its rebates reward heat pumps, insulation and similar upgrades, not a like-for-like furnace or central AC replacement. So if lowering your energy bills and qualifying for a rebate is a priority, the honest question to ask is whether a cold-climate heat pump install fits your home before you decide, rather than counting on funding for a straight swap.
